Summary of reviewsAuberge du Renard'eau, nestled in the heart of a charming village in Burgundy, offers an idyllic and picturesque setting that beautifully blends historical authenticity with modern conveniences. Guests frequently laud the tranquility and scenic beauty of the location, accentuated by a quaint village ambiance and nearby attractions such as abbeys and caves. The medieval charm of the inn, complete with large fireplaces and cozy decor, enriches the overall atmosphere, making it a perfect stopover for travelers.
The hotel's dining experience is particularly outstanding with its restaurant receiving high praise for the quality and flavor of its meals. Traditional and rustic French dishes, prepared over a wood fire or by the fireplace, contribute to a delicious and memorable dining experience. The warm and welcoming ambiance, complemented by friendly and helpful staff, enhances the enjoyment. While some diners find the prices slightly high, the excellence of the food and service often justifies the cost.
The breakfast at Auberge du Renard'eau, while tasty and varied with fresh croissants, pastries, fruit and coffee, receives mixed reviews. Guests appreciate the quality but note the simplicity and limited options of the offering. Some express disappointment at the lack of a buffet and the late start time, which can be inconvenient for early travelers.
Rooms at the inn offer spacious and charming accommodations with features like four-poster beds and jacuzzi baths. The rustic feel of the rooms adds to the authentic experience, although some guests find the furnishings dated and suggest updates are needed. Cleanliness is generally good, but isolated issues in bathrooms indicate room for improvement. The historical ambiance is romantic and inviting, even if modern comforts could be enhanced.
A key highlight of Auberge du Renard'eau is its exceptional staff, who are frequently commended for their friendliness, attentiveness and excellent service. English-speaking personnel ensure smooth communication for international visitors, contributing to the welcoming and hospitable environment.
Ideal for families, the inn offers spacious rooms with separate areas for children and family-friendly amenities. Activities like weekend caving and calm entertainment during meals make it a great destination for a relaxed family getaway.
While the hotel's charm and setting are highly appreciated, the beds receive mixed reviews. Although visually appealing, the firmness and discomfort of the mattresses are commonly noted. Light sleepers might find the old-fashioned beds less comfortable, despite their aesthetic appeal.
Overall, Auberge du Renard'eau is a delightful retreat full of character and charm, offering a warm and memorable experience enhanced by exceptional staff and a beautiful, historical setting. Enhancements in breakfast offerings, room updates and bed comfort could further elevate the guest experience at this enchanting inn. Show more

Do you accept dogs in all rooms? Yes
Is there an extra charge? Yes, € 5 per night
Should the dog owner notify you before checking in? Yes, During the booking process
What is the maximum number of dogs per room? Up to 2 dogs are allowed in each room.
Is there a maximum weight of dogs accepted? No
Are there any leash-free play areas? No
Should the dog be kenneled/kept in a pet carrier at all times in public areas? Yes
Should the dog remain leashed at all times in the room? No
Should the dog remain leashed at all times in public areas? Yes
Are the dogs allowed on the furniture? No
Are the dogs allowed on beds? No
What are the basic requirements to accept a dog?
Must not be aggressive
Must be clean
Must not have fleas
Must have proof of current vaccinations
Must use designated areas
Owners must clean pet waste immediately
Owners are responsible for any damage caused by the dog
Must not bathe in the bathtub
Must not be left unattended in the room
Except for dogs, do you also accept other pets? Yes

Breakfast
Guest reviews of 'Auberge du Renard'eau' paint a mixed picture of the breakfast experience with a notable focus on both highlights and areas needing improvement. Many guests appreciate the quality and taste, describing the breakfast as tasty, sufficient and even delicious with freshly baked croissants, pastries, fruit and lots of coffee. Cheese, ham, yogurt and additional spreads are available upon request, adding variety to the standard offerings. Positive comments also highlight the hearty and plentiful nature of the breakfast, which some guests found enjoyable, especially when accompanied by a roaring fire.
On the other hand, several guests point out limitations in choice and availability. The breakfast menu is perceived as basic and not very extensive with some expressing disappointment at the lack of a buffet option and the conventional nature of the spread. The breakfast's availability from only 8 AM—or 8:30 AM on some occasions—is considered a drawback, especially for those needing an earlier start. Additionally, issues such as old bread and the price/quality ratio have been mentioned.
With a balance of commendation for its taste and critiques for its simplicity and timing, 'Auberge du Renard'eau' offers a breakfast experience that satisfies many but leaves some guests hoping for improvements.
